Frequently Asked Questions Why Live in Brownstown CDP

Is Brownstown CDP a good place to live?
Brownstown CDP is a good place to live. Brownstown CDP is considered very car-dependent and somewhat bikeable. Brownstown CDP is a neighborhood with a crime score of 2, making it safer than the average neighborhood in the U.S. Brownstown CDP has 3 parks for recreational activities. It has a median age of 41. The average household income is $116,143 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 31.3% of residents. A majority of residents in Brownstown CDP are home owners, with 14.6% of residents renting and 85.4%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Brownstown CDP?
The median home price in Brownstown CDP is $415,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$83,000 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.5%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$2,100 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$90K a year to afford the median home price in Brownstown CDP. The average household income in Brownstown CDP is $116K.
